1937 CADILLAC
8-Cylinder - Series 60
The Series 60 (new last year) added a new Convertible Sedan body style. Throughout the line there
were a few body changes including:
- Eggcrate grill and hood louvers;
- Higher fenders with lengthwise crease along the top;
- Set of three horizontal bars each side of grill;
- Bumpers carrying the Cadillac emblem;
- Swinging rear quarter windows;
- All steel body construction.
Series 60 shared many features with the LaSalle, but used the 346 cu. in. V-8 engine. A Series 60 Commercial
Chassis with 1603/8 in. wheelbase was offered.
8-Cylinder - Series 65
The new Series 37-65 was offered in only one body style—a five passenger
Touring Sedan built by Fisher on the 131 in. wheelbase used on Series 70 cars.
This car was longer and heavier than the Series 60 at a price below that of the
Fleetwood bodies cars.
8-Cylinder - Series 70 & 75
The Series 37-70 and 37-75 bodies were the same as the corresponding 1936 models except for:
-
Drip molding running from the bottom of the front pillar up and over the
doors and rear quarter window;
- New fenders and bumpers;
- Headlights rigidly attached (adjusted by moving reflector);
- Wheel discs incorporated a hub cap;
- Built-in trunk used on most bodies.
A diecast eggcrate grill was used, but the hood louver treatment differed from that
used on Fisher bodied cars.
Chrome diecast strips were used at the rear of the hood side panels.
A seven passenger Fisher bodied Special Touring Sedan, with or without division, was
offered on the 138 in. wheelbase.
These two body styles had the eggcrate hood louvers typical of all Fisher bodied
Cadillacs for 1937.
The Business Car line included eight passenger versions of these Special Sedans plus
eight passenger versions of four Fleetwood body styles.
The eighth passenger was seated with two others on the auxiliary seats.
A Commercial Chassis on a 156 in. wheelbase was offered.
Engine changes included:
- Lighter flywheel;
- Generator relocated in the Vee;
- Oil filter installed;
- New carburetor with full-automatic electric choke:
- Oil bath air cleaner;
- Relocated distributor.
A new transmission design featured:
- Pin-type synchronizers;
- Shifter rails relocated to side of case;
- Cover on bottom of case;
- Extension integral with transmission mainshaft.

ENGINE
| Type | Ninety degree, L-head V-8. |
| Cylinders | Eight Cylinder. |
| Block | Cast iron block (blocks cast enbloc with crankcase). |
| Bore & Stroke | 3.50 x 4.50 in. |
| Displacement | 346 cu. in. |
| Compression Ratio | 6.25:1 std. 5.75:1 opt. |
| Brake Horsepower | 135 @ 3400 rpm |
| SAE/Taxable Horsepower | 39.20. |
| Main bearings | Three. |
| Valve lifters | Hydraulic. |
| Carburetor | Stromberg AA-25. |

TECHNICAL
| Transmission | Selective, synchro transmission. |
| Speeds | 3 Forward, 1 Reverse |
| Controls | Left Hand Drive, center control, emergency lever at left under panel (RHD opt.). |
| Clutch | Single disc clutch. |
| Drive | Shaft drive, Hotchkiss. |
| Axle | Semi floating rear axle, spiral bevel drive. (Series 37-60 Hypoid). |
| Overall ratio | 4.3:1 (Series 37-60 3.69:1). |
| Brakes | Hydraulic brakes on four wheels. |
| Wheels | Disc wheels. |
| Wheel size | 16 in. |

HISTORICAL NOTES
- Introduced: November, 1936.
- Model year sales: [Series 60] 7003; [Series 65] 2401; [Series 70, 75] 4232.
- Model year production: [Series 60] 7003; [Series 65] 2401; [Series 70, 75) 4232.
- The general manager was Nicholas Dreystadt.
